Salvia verticillata

This is a Salvia which is widespread throughout central Europe and Western Asia. A very attractive, hardy species, this has several forms, the best known being Salvia verticillata 'Purple Rain'. Up to 2 ft. tall with a width of 4 ft., this is a useful plant for a herbaceous border, best replaced every 2 or 3 years as it can become untidy. It sets seeds, which could be considered to be a nuisance, but seedlings can easibly be eradicated. There is a dirty white form of this salvia, but I cannot recommend it.
